Puppy Unleashed on thumb drive: boot hangs at "switch root"

Posted: Sat 22 Dec 2007, 02:26
by polygonal
I seem to have no luck in trying Puppy Unleashed (and any modification of pup_300.sfs); when my computer boots, it stops at "switch-root" and never goes past that. The computer boots fine if I use the normal version of puppy. I'm booting from usb, and after createpuppy script done its work, I simply copied pup_300.sfs, initrd.gz, and vmlinuz to my usb drive. I did omit some packages from my puppy unleashed package collection, but I don't think I removed anything essential (hopefully).

Can any one give me a pointer as to what might have gone wrong?
